Understanding Noise Pollution: Sources and Impact

bathtub faucet replacement parts

Noise pollution, often overlooked, is a significant environmental concern with far-reaching consequences for both physical and mental health. It arises from diverse sources, each contributing to the overall cacophony in our living spaces. From bustling cities to suburban neighborhoods, noise from traffic, construction sites, industrial activities, and even household appliances can create a constant symphony of disturbance. These sounds, especially when persistent and excessive, have been linked to increased stress levels, sleep disturbances, and even cardiovascular issues among those exposed.

In addressing noise problems, it’s essential to identify the sources. For instance, a simple bathtub faucet replacement part could significantly reduce water-related noises in a home. Similarly, managing traffic noise might involve urban planning strategies like road resurfacing or installing sound barriers. By understanding the origins of noise pollution and implementing tailored solutions, communities can strive for quieter, healthier environments, ensuring a better quality of life for their residents.

Common Noise Issues in Residential Settings

bathtub faucet replacement parts

In residential settings, noise problems can stem from various sources, often impacting the comfort and quality of life for occupants. One common issue is excessive noise from neighboring properties, such as loud music, pet noises, or conversations that carry through thin walls or inadequate insulation. This is particularly problematic in urban areas where buildings are close together, creating a ‘labyrinth’ of sound that can be difficult to mitigate.

Another overlooked source of residential noise is the bathroom, specifically the bathtub faucet. Old or faulty faucets can produce annoying squeaks or drip-related sounds that can disrupt peaceful moments and sleep patterns. Fortunately, addressing these issues is straightforward with accessible bathtub faucet replacement parts readily available. Upgrading these components not only helps to create a quieter home environment but also contributes to overall energy efficiency by reducing water waste associated with leaky fixtures.

Bathtub Faucet Replacement: A Quiet Solution

bathtub faucet replacement parts

Many homes struggle with noisy plumbing, and one common culprit is the bathtub faucet. The gurgling or banging sounds can be disruptive and often indicate worn-out parts. Fortunately, replacing your bathtub faucet is a straightforward solution that offers more than just peace and quiet; it’s also an opportunity to upgrade to more efficient and stylish fixtures.

Choosing the right bathtub faucet replacement parts involves considering factors like material (brass or ceramic for durability), finish (chrome, brushed nickel, or matte black for aesthetics), and additional features (such as water-saving options). By selecting a high-quality replacement, you can bid farewell to noisy faucets and enjoy a quieter, more serene bathroom environment.
